Importance of CSIR NET

The CSIR UGC NET examination is conducted to determine eligibility for Junior Research Fellowship (JRF), appointment as Assistant Professor, and admission to PhD programs. It is a gateway for candidates who wish to pursue a career in teaching and research in science and technology.

The exam covers various scientific subjects including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, Biology, and Geology. NTA also organizes the test for disciplines such as Mathematical Sciences, Chemical Sciences, Life Sciences, Physical Sciences, and Earth, Atmospheric, Ocean and Planetary Sciences.

Because of its vast scope, CSIR NET is considered an essential qualification for aspirants seeking academic and research opportunities in India. Successful candidates become eligible for research fellowships, academic positions, and doctoral studies in top institutions.

Minimum qualifying marks

NTA has specified the qualifying marks for different categories. Candidates from General, EWS, and OBC categories must score at least 33 percent to qualify. For SC, ST, and PwD categories, the minimum qualifying mark is 25 percent.

Only those who secure these minimum scores will be considered eligible for Junior Research Fellowship or Assistant Professorship. The qualifying criteria ensure that only the most competent candidates move forward in the process.

How to check CSIR NET June 2025 result

Once the result is declared, candidates will be able to access it online. The process to check the result is simple and requires basic login credentials.

Steps to download the result:

  1. Visit the official website csirnet.nta.ac.in.

  2. On the homepage, click the link for “CSIR UGC NET June 2025 Result.”

  3. Enter your login details and submit.

  4. The result will appear on the screen.

  5. Download the scorecard and take a printout for future reference.

Candidates are advised to keep their login details such as application number and date of birth ready before checking the result.
